Whistler's La Cantina taco shop opening in downtown Vancouver

Aug 25 2017, 3:11 am

Vancouver’s taco game is about to get another established contender: Whistler’s La Cantina taco bar is opening up a downtown Van location.

Taking over the now-defunct Nelson Grocery Store at 755 Nelson (at Granville), La Cantina is about to launch into their space reno, with an eye to open in October.

A rep for the restaurant tells Daily Hive the 1,500-square-foot Vancouver La Cantina location will boast 50 seats, and will offer a menu of tacos, burritos, soups, and salads familiar to fans of the Whistler restaurant–with some fresh new items set to debut at the OG outpost this September ahead of the Vancouver launch.

The eats at La Cantina include options that are gluten-free, dairy-free, or vegan, and their bev menu includes everything from Mexican soda pops to beer and margaritas.

La Cantina is from the same team behind Whistler’s popular Mexican Corner restaurant; their taco shop is located in the Village right across from Olympic Plaza, with an Express location in Function Junction.

The affordable counter-service taqueria, with meat and veg tacos running in the $3-4 apiece range and burritos in the $11-12 zone, aims to offer customers a kick-back place to hang out. Vancouver customers will be welcome to eat and hang at their new La Cantina when they open from 11 am to 10 pm daily.
